AT&T's Winter Storm Preparation Tips for Alexandria Residents
How to Stay Safe and Connected During Winter Storm Stella

As Alexandria residents brace for Winter Storm Stella’s arrival, AT&T has some tips to help residents stay safe and connected during the storm. While many have prepared by stocking up on groceries, shovels and emergency supplies, residents should also make sure their smartphones are fully charged.
Smartphones are critical for those who lose power – they can be lifelines during emergencies, provide you with the latest storm news and help keep you in touch with family and friends.
Here are some other tips from AT&T to help you stay safe and connected:

- Become An Amateur Storm Tracker: Use weather apps, like AccuWeather, The Weather Channel, Weatherbug or Weathermob to track the storm.
- Take Advantage of Emergency Services Apps: Download apps like FEMA or Winter Survival Kit, which will help you find your current location, call 911, notify your friends and family, calculate how long you can run your engine to keep warm and help you stay safe from carbon monoxide poisoning.
- Keep Your Phone Charged: Make sure all of your devices and backup battery boosters are charged before the storm arrives.
- Use Text Messaging: During an emergency, text messages go through quicker than voice calls because they require less system resources. Text messages also use less battery than phone calls.
- Use Your Phone As A Flashlight: Use your device’s special features or download an app to turn your phone into an effective flashlight – this is extremely useful during a power outage.
